Subject: Handover — Pixelbin image cache leak

Hi Dario,

Handing over the Pixelbin memory leak investigation. The image cache on the render nodes grows steadily under load and never releases evicted entries; we suspect the thumbnail variant map holds stale references. Heap dumps from Tuesday are in the shared drive under pixelbin-leak. New folks: restart the cache workers if RSS passes 6 GB. To inspect the cache metadata tables directly, connect with the string below.

Thanks,
Mirela

replica DSN, kajep-yahag: mssql://praok_svc:iF@db-8d68.plorvaio.local:5432/eliion

## Data stores — FD leak hunt

While chasing the leaked file descriptors in the Marrowgate exporter, we learned it holds a handle per unflushed batch — so the stores page now lists which services pool connections properly. Short version: everything except the legacy audit writer is fine. If you're cutting a release, verify the audit writer against staging first; it connects using the line below.

primary connection of yagep-kahip = redis://giliel_svc:zYiKsLL2PLpfPL@db-348f.xolmarsys.corp:5432/fenwyn

### Step 4 — Migrate restock schedules

The Snackorbit restock planner now stores machine routes and fill forecasts in the new planner_v2 schema. Run the migration script once; it copies schedules, normalizes slot codes, and marks legacy rows read-only. Future maintainers should note that rollback is only supported within 24 hours of migration. Point the script at the planner database using the connection string below.

replica DSN, yahog-kawig: redis://istox_svc:um@db-8a67.halixforge.test:5432/frawyn

Welcome aboard! Quick tour of the env vars the fuel-usage report job cares about. `FUEL_REPORT_INTERVAL` sets how often the aggregator runs (hours, default 24). `FLEET_REGION_FILTER` narrows which depots get included — leave blank for everything. `REPORT_FORMAT` accepts `csv` or `pdf`; ops prefers csv. Don't touch `ODOMETER_SOURCE` unless someone on the telemetry side asks you to. Last thing: the job uploads finished reports to the internal archive, and the upload credential it uses is set on the very next line of the env file.

env line for fafof-fahag: LEDGER_TOKEN5=f8790